House raising services involve elevating an existing structure to a higher level, often to address issues related to flooding, drainage, or foundation stability. The process typically includes lifting the entire building, then reinforcing or replacing the foundation before lowering the home back onto its new, higher support. This service can help improve the resilience of a property against floodwaters or rising water levels, making it a practical solution in flood-prone areas or regions experiencing increased weather-related challenges.
This service addresses several common problems faced by homeowners, such as flood damage, mold growth, and foundation deterioration. Raising a house can prevent future water intrusion during heavy rains or storms, reducing the risk of water damage and costly repairs. Additionally, it can help preserve the structural integrity of a property that has settled unevenly or is experiencing foundation issues, thereby extending the lifespan of the home and maintaining its value.
Properties that typically utilize house raising services include older homes in flood zones, waterfront properties, or those situated on uneven terrain. Commercial buildings located in areas susceptible to flooding may also benefit from this service. In some cases, homeowners choose to raise their houses to create additional usable space beneath the structure, such as parking or storage, while also ensuring the property remains protected from water-related damages.

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$15,000 and $50,000, depending on the size and foundation type. For example, a small home may be closer to $15,000, while larger or more complex projects can approach $50,000.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all expense varies based on the home's height, foundation condition, and local labor rates. Additional work such as foundation repairs or utility relocations can increase the total cost.
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Glen Burnie, MD, might expect to spend around $20,000 to $35,000 for standard house raising projects. Costs tend to rise with the home's size and structural complexity.
Cost Variability - Costs can vary significantly depending on specific project requirements, with some jobs costing less than $15,000 or exceeding $50,000 for extensive modifications or custom need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is house raising? House raising involves elevating a home to prevent flood damage, improve foundation stability, or meet local building requirements by using specialized lifting and support techniques.
Why consider house raising services? House raising can protect a property from flood risks, increase usable space, and help meet local regulations or zoning laws.
How do local pros perform house raising? Professionals typically use hydraulic jacks, temporary supports, and lifting equipment to carefully elevate the structure, then reinforce the foundation before lowering it onto new supports.
What types of homes can be raised? Many types of homes, including wood-frame and brick structures, can be raised, depending on their design and foundation type.
